  • Gran Canaria Tip: What Are The Best Car Hire Companies?
    Gran Canaria Tip: What Are The Best Car Hire Companies?

    This is one of the most common questions we get in our Facebook Group (with over 30,000 members) and fortunately, it is an easy one to answer. The Gran Canaria Info admin team and the fans in our Facebook group agree...

    The best car hire companies in Gran Canaria are local ones with desk at the airport and honest pricing policies that don't have any hidden insurance or fuel deposit costs. They just rent you a good car at a good price with no fuss at all. 

    We recommend Mr Car Hire Gran Canaria (Nick); an idependent car rental professional who works with all the main local rental companies in Gran Canaria. This means that he can always find you a good deal.

    Mr Car Hire also offers fully comprehensive insurance on all car rental, three-day bookings, and delively of your car right to your door anywhere in Gran Canaria. 

    We advise all Gran Canaria visitors to avoid booking the cheapest possible car on generic car rental websites or via their flight company because you often end up paying large deposits, extra fuel and insurance costs and all kinds of other costs once you arrive to pick up your car at the airport.
